Croydon Station temporarily closed

Croydon Station is temporarily closed. While the station is closed, trains are not stopping at Croydon Station. A shuttle bus service is connecting passengers from Croydon to trains at Ringwood East and Mooroolbark stations. Catch the shuttle bus from the train replacement bus stop on Devon Street, Croydon.

All facilities, including myki services and the Parkiteer are unavailable. Alternative bike hoops are available near the park at 99 Main Street, Croydon.

The new Croydon Station will open by Spring 2024.

For the safety and comfort of all passengers, there are restrictions on what you may take with you on buses.

You cannot:

  • Take a conventional bike on a bus or tram (only folding bikes that meet the size criteria).
  • Take an animal on a bus or tram unless it is in a suitable container. Exceptions apply for assistance dogs.
  • Take a surfboard on a tram or a bus.
